What is the IB Diploma Programme and why is it important?

It is an academically challenging and balanced program of education with final examinations that prepares students, aged 15 to 18, for success at university and life beyond.

It has been designed to address the intellectual, social, emotional and physical wellbeing of students, and it has gained recognition and respect from the world’s leading universities. Students develop the skills and a positive attitude towards learning that will prepare them for higher education. The value which top US universities place on the IBDP can be seen from the university acceptance figures below.

The Diploma Programme prepares students for effective participation in a rapidly evolving and increasingly global society.
